What is Pilates?
Pilates is a holistic movement method created to promote alignment of the mind and body. Grounded in technique, controlled movement sequences, and regulated breath, Pilates encourages ergonomic postural alignment, core strength, and balanced musculature. Since its creation, Pilates has continued to gain respect from health professionals as a reputable method for injury prevention, rehabilitation, and sustainable exercise. The benefits of practicing Pilates regularly include improved core strength and stability, postural alignment, flexibility, balance, and endurance.
What is Reformer Pilates?
The Pilates Reformer is the most popular and versatile piece of Pilates equipment around the world. Invented by Joseph Pilates, the Reformer is designed to utilize spring-resistance technology to intelligently strengthen and improve muscular function. Exercises on the Reformer incorporate functional movement and involve pulling, pressing, or holding a moving carriage steady while you resist tension from anchored springs. With the unique ability to adjust spring tensions for each exercise and ability level, it’s possible to progress and tailor exercises to every body for every exercise - whether it be to provide more support to the absolute beginner, or more challenge to the most experienced Pilates lovers.
